Contract Applications Sought to Operate Southwestern Wake County License Plate Agency

ROCKY MOUNT –The N.C. Division of Motor Vehicles is seeking applicants for a commissioned contractor to operate a license plate agency (LPA) in southwestern Wake County.  

The previous agency, at 408 Village Walk Dr., in Holly Springs, permanently closed on August 10. 
 
In North Carolina, NCDMV oversees LPAs, but the agencies are managed by private businesses or local governments.

For people interested in operating an LPA in southwestern Wake County, completed applications must be returned to NCDMV no later than Oct. 7.  The applications (Form MVR-93 or Form MVR-93AA) can be found on the Connect NCDOT website. Interested applicants may call 919-615-8105 with questions. 

The division’s policy is to open applications to operate a license plate agency after the expiration or end of a contract, or when the need arises for a new or additional agency in a certain county.

LPAs offer vehicle registration services and title transactions, as well as vehicle license plate renewals, replacement tags and duplicate registrations. Currently, 127 license plate agencies operate in North Carolina.
